ROMERO LOPEZ, Teresita de Jesús; RODRIGUEZ FIALLO, Humberto  and  MASO MOSQUEDA, Arquímides. Characterization of wastewater generated in a Cuban textile industry. riha [online]. 2016, vol.37, n.3, pp.46-58. ISSN 1680-0338.

This work was done in a Cuban textile industry, located in Havana, and aimed to gather all the information in the industry related to the physical and chemical characteristics of the wastewater, and to make a veredict on the operation of the Cleaner Production Plan in operation in the industry since 2006. An update of the effluent quality was also conducted in 2015 and concluded that this industry, even without a treatment system for its wastewater, complies with regulations for dumping to the sewage system, which does not avoid the need to install their own conventional plant and reuse the treated water in their facilities.

Keywords : textile industry; wastewater; treatment.
